Membership and other information is available on their Web site. Some issues are filmed … WebAbout Kansas Census Records. The first federal census available for Kansas is 1860. There are federal censuses publicly available for 1860, 1870, 1880, 1900, 1910, 1920, 1930, and 1940. There were territorial censuses in 1855, 1857, and 1859. Alternative names: Parish church: Parish registers begin: Parish registers: 1792 Bishop’s Transcripts: 1830 Nonconformists … blake lively bathing suit picturesWebBlackburn Name Meaning. English: habitational name from any of various places called Blackburn but especially the one in Lancashire so named with Old English blæc ‘dark’ + burna ‘stream’. This surname is found mainly in northern England. Source: Dictionary of … fracture types chartWebMorley History Group. 343 likes.
